Leadership Overview

Agri-Mark has 4 executives leading key functions including strategy, finance, and operations.

Driven by a commitment to quality, Agri-Mark produces, supplies, and markets a comprehensive range of dairy products, impacting the food and bakery industries with its diverse offerings and dedication to consumer satisfaction.

Leadership Roles at Agri-Mark

  • Chief Executive Officer & President - William Beaton
  • Chief Executive Officer & President - Ed Townley
  • Chief Financial Officer - Daniel Serna
  • President - Paul Johnston
